The Uinta Highline Trail is a premier high-alpine backpacking route traversing the scenic Uinta Mountains of northeastern Utah. This nearly 45-mile trail showcases pristine alpine meadows, crystal-clear mountain lakes, and expansive ridge-line vistas while maintaining a relatively moderate elevation profile for its length. The trail is renowned for its remote wilderness character, abundant wildlife viewing opportunities, and access to some of Utah's most unspoiled high country.
